Interview with Karen Cabrera McDonlad '18, 2019 November 01
Scope and Contents
Oral history interview and transcript with Karen Cabrera McDonald, Davidson College class of 2018. During the interview, Karen Cabrera McDonald discusses the importance of the STRIDE program, serving on the executive board of OLAS, working with SIAD (Student Initiative for Academic Diversity), the need for programming for Spanish-speaking families, tensions between international students raised in Latin America versus Latinx students raised in the United States, work with the student group Queers and Allies, and the need for a Latinx alumni group.
